DESCRIPTION:On view from August 26-September 23rd in the Doran and Brant Ga
 lleries.\n\nThis exhibition brings together the practices of MassArt’s r
 ecently hired tenure track faculty (2023–25)\, foregrounding the relatio
 nship between research and pedagogy. The selected works are accompanied by
  teaching philosophies\, offering an insight into the frameworks that shap
 e each artists’ studio and classroom.\n\nThe approaches are diverse yet 
 interconnected: Sandra Erbacher examines systems of power and representati
 on\; Youjin Moon cultivates cross-disciplinary investigations into media a
 nd form\; Tore Terrasi emphasizes discovery through experimentation and fa
 ilure\; Caroline Hu situates science as a profoundly human and communicati
 ve practice\; and Marjee Levine frames sculpture as a process of transform
 ation\, kinship\, and resilience.\n\nTaken together\, the exhibition artic
 ulates teaching as a mode of practice in its own right\; an endeavor that 
 not only transmits knowledge but also produces new ways of thinking\, maki
 ng\, and fostering a community.
